'Secret polls' sealed decision to annex Crimea: Putin
April 11, 2014  00:11
Russian President Vladimir Putin said today that his decision to take the Crimean peninsula under Russian control was made final after "secret polls" showed that its people wanted to be ruled by Moscow. 

"My decisions were finalised after people's attitudes became clear," Putin said. "We weren't prepared for such a turn of events. To tell you the truth, we could imagine how people felt but did not know for sure."
